Output 30100843604e5c54ab49783682a76e843878f42411c02570275ff9d307a34604:2

value
14527111530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ff8beae9a4314fc345d8fb045881f7264a4253 OP_EQUAL
address
MTE6wbJRcoAgo17iPfr9eKXEk2nRbnqgNQ
transaction
30100843604e5c54ab49783682a76e843878f42411c02570275ff9d307a34604
spent
true